A- Degreaser-2.2 > Acidifier-2.0 system.
In this wet cleaning process the objective is to reach into the leather structure to remove body oil, grease and sweat that is causing the damages. Sweat has a certain percentage of ammonia and urea that causes the leather to denature. That is, it shifted the pH value of the protein fiber ionic positive that breaks bond with the common leather constituents like the ionic positive fatliquor (fat and oil), like poles repels.
B- Hydrator-3.3 > Fatliquor-5.0 > Hydrator-3.3 system.
The above A- and B- is a considered as a ‘wet-process’ and that the transition between A- and B- has to be kept wet at least 25% total moisture content. The leather is only highly recommended to remain wet after sufficient Fatliquor-5.0 is replenished, otherwise the cracks will accentuate or make worse. So be careful during this wet-process, should always have the leather structure wet.
C- Impregnator-26 > Bond-3D > Stucco-90 system.
This is the ‘dry-process’ and repairs are performed accordingly. Remember that any stiffness will subject to easy cracking. Repairs performed should remain as supple as the surrounding areas to be long lasting.
D- Custom Color Matching > Adhesor-73 > Micro54 > 2Tone-37 > MicroTop-54S > Protector-B/B+
This is the sequence for color refinishing.
